Architecture of Observation Towers

It seems to be human nature to enjoy a view, getting the higher ground and taking in our surroundings has become a significant aspect of architecture across the world. Observation towers which allow visitors to climb and observe their surroundings, provide a chance to take in the beauty of the land while at the same time adding something unique and impressive to the landscape.

Model Making In Architecture

The importance of model making in architecture could be thought to have reduced in recent years. With the introduction of new and innovative architecture design technology, is there still a place for model making in architecture? Stanton Williams, director at Stirling Prize-winning practice, Gavin Henderson, believes that it’s more important than ever.

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

From the 1930s until the 1970s, asbestos was extensively employed in construction materials. It was used in pipe insulation and fireproofing, as well as cements, plasters, car breaks, and much more. The exposure to this mineral can lead to a variety of severe medical conditions including mesothelioma and other respiratory diseases.

A licensed New York m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ims to seek comp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is vital to select the right attorney for this kind of claim.

Find a Specialist

When asbestos is mined and processed, the tiny fibers separate easily and can be inhaled. This can cause lung cancer, mesothelioma and asbestosis. People who handle asbestos directly are at greater risk, however anyone can breathe asbestos. This kind of exposure, also known as secondary exposure is a risk to anyone who comes in contact with the worker's contaminated clothing or equipment. This includes relatives that wash the uniforms of the worker as well as anyone living in the same household. This could happen on ships and bases of military, where workers wear the identical uniform for a long time.

Construction, insulation, shipyards, mining, milling and other jobs can be exposed to asbestos. This was especially the case in the United States between the 1950s and the 1990s. Workers could be exposed to asbestos when old buildings were demolished or renovated and also when building materials were damaged. Even in the present, the demolition or remodeling of older buildings could release asbestos in the air.

It can be a lengthy period of time between exposure to asbestos and mesothelioma onset symptoms or other symptoms. If you suspect you could be suffering from a disease caused by asbestos or have been exposed to asbestos, it is crucial to talk with a doctor.

Your doctor will examine your lungs and ask about any past work that might have involved asbestos. If they suspect that you suffer from an asbestos-related illness, they will likely send you to a specialist to get more tests. Asbestos-related diseases can be detected by chest X-rays or CT scans. However, they might not show up in these tests.

These diseases can affect the lungs, heart and abdomen. It is r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

Some experts believe that the best method to protect yourself from asbestos exposure is to avoid all kinds of dust and to never smoke or work in industries that could use it. Others say this isn't possible and people should be screened often for signs of asbestos-related illnesses.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your medical history and employment records to create a timeline of your exposure to asbestos. Then, they will construct your case by assembling evidence to prove that you were exposed to asbestos and that the exposure caused harm. The complaint will be sent to all defendants and they will be given 30 days in which to respond. The defendants typically deny responsibility and will try to pin blame on someone else. This is why you need a team of attorneys who knows how to manage these claims.

Once your lawyer has all the documentation required they will file your asbestos case. They will file it with the state court system that is most appropriate for your situation. During this time period, the att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ery. During this time, they share information about the case with the opposing side. Asbestos lawsuits are different from other personal injury cases, which is why it's important to hire a mesothelioma specialist. They have access to a database that shows patients the asbestos products they worked with during their work. It makes it easier for patients to determine the products responsible for their exposure to asbestos.

They will also know which companies are responsible for your exposure. This includes the makers of asbestos-containing products that you handled, and the owners of buildings containing as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.

You need to act quickly in the event that you or someone you love has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, lung cancer or any other asbestos-related disease. The statutes of limitations vary by jurisdiction and you have a a limited amount of time to file a claim for asbestos.
